Traducción al inglés:spastic quadriparesia / tetraparesis
Explicación:
Tetraparesis or tetraplegia is a neurological condition in which all four limbs are weak (paresis) or paralyzed (plegia).

It is not the same a quadriplegia than a quadripasresia (tetraparesis).


Spastic tetraparesis
MedGen UID: C0575059
Synonym: Spastic quadriparesis SNOMED CT:Spastic quadriparesis (298282001); Spastic tetraparesis (298282001)

Spastic tetraparesis/quadriparesis
Spastic weakness affecting all four limbs.
[From previous link]

Spastic tetraplegia
Synonym: Spastic quadriplegia
SNOMED
(...)
A type of spastic cerebral palsy characterized by increased muscle tone of all four extremities.
